October 25, 2020Diversity in the UK WorkplaceThis is a special podcast all about championing and building up mentees and colleagues who are classed as Ethnic Minorities. Our discussion is based around the proactive work of business resource groups aimed at creating molecular support groups who can act as independent auditing houses for BAME communities for inhouse resource & HR divisions.We touch on lightly the pressure of being the "token black person" carrying the weight of answering on behalf of a majority and having the BRAVE to flag racial injustices and cultural stigmatism within Corporate.Both of my speakers hold high positions in major London businesses but not accountable for how their onboarding , ear bending and progression of race equality plays out in their organisations. However they are not representatives and their views are neither partisan or against - they speak as individual colleagues who have experienced and continue to do every day a unique perspective of what Diversity and Inclusion means to them . Lets supportive Everyone , C-suite- Exec Office , Board, HR , Employees and Unions to work together to ensure our next generation are treated equal and without predjudice. ...more25minPlay

October 25, 2020Single Parent StigmaMonica and I dig deep into why being a solo hero is so stigmatised. We explore some of the below topics:Why is it assumed all black men cheat ?Why do we begrudge "baby mothers" with different dadsWhy is it okay to be a "Gallas"Marital abandonment I would hope us scratching the surface on single parenthood will bare compassion and a curiosity to listen to our individual stories as like tapestry's they are all very unique. Our stories couldn't measure on a Richter scale how far apart they lie , one a blended family working in unison and the other abandoned by her husband during pregnancy without closure.Both share the growing pains of motherhood alone but equally prevail strength and prove a mothers love beyond anything is powerful and inspiring....more15minPlay
